selftests/timers/posix-timers: Validate SIGEV_NONE
Posix timers with a delivery mode of SIGEV_NONE deliver no signals but the
remaining expiry time must be readable via timer_gettime() for both one
shot and interval timers.
That's implemented correctly for regular posix timers but broken for posix
CPU timers.
Add a self test so the fixes can be verified.
